The Role of the Internist
The internist is your health gatekeeper. They shepherd you through the healthcare system. When you need a specialist, they find the right one. When you need tests, they arrange them. They keep track of your health journey. They ensure every doctor on the team is up-to-date with your condition.
The Internist’s Toolbox
The internist has a variety of tools to help provide care:
- Communication: They talk with you, learn about your problems, and understand your fears.
- Knowledge: They understand a vast array of medical conditions and treatments.
